gemma-2-27b-it-llamafile (via) Justine Tunney shipped llamafile packages of Google's new openly licensed (though definitely not open source) Gemma 2 27b model this morning.
I downloaded the gemma-2-27b-it.Q5_1.llamafile version (20.5GB) to my Mac, ran chmod 755 gemma-2-27b-it.Q5_1.llamafile and then ./gemma-2-27b-it.Q5_1.llamafile and now I'm trying it out through the llama.cpp default web UI in my browser. It works great.
It's a very capable model - currently sitting at position 12 on the LMSYS Arena making it the highest ranked open weights model - one position ahead of Llama-3-70b-Instruct and within striking distance of the GPT-4 class models.
